As a Senior Building Surveyor, you’ll take responsibility for delivering a range of professional and project services, ensuring clients receive expert advice and exceptional delivery standards.
Your key duties will include:
Preparing detailed building survey reports for a variety of property types
Advising clients on dilapidations and preparing reasoned recommendations
Inspecting and compiling schedules of condition
Acting as Contract Administrator to ensure smooth project delivery
Developing scheme designs, cost plans, programmes, and specifications of work
Managing tender documentation and supporting procurement decisions
Undertaking party wall inspections and negotiations
Supporting tenant handovers and overseeing new-build developments
Providing clear and consistent reporting to clients
Attending site inspections and surveys across the UK as required
